Save energy
When you have fully charged the battery
and disconnected the charger from the
device, remember to also unplug the
charger from the wall outlet.
You do not need to charge your battery so
often if you do the following:
Close and disable applications,
services, and connections when you
are not using them.
Decrease the brightness of the screen.
Set the device to enter the power
saver mode after the minimum period
of inactivity, if available in your
device.
Disable unnecessary sounds, such as
keypad tones. Set the volume of your
device to an average level.
Recycle
Did you remember to recycle your old
device? 65-80% of the materials in a Nokia
mobile phone can be recycled. Always
return your used electronic products,
batteries, and packaging materials to a
dedicated collection point. By doing this,
you help prevent uncontrolled waste
disposal and promote the recycling of
materials. Check how to recycle your
Nokia products at www.nokia.com/
werecycle or www.nokia.mobi/
werecycle.
You may recycle the packaging and user
guides at your local recycling point.

Battery and charger information
Your device is powered by a rechargeable battery. The battery
intended for use with this device is BL-4CT. Nokia may make
additional battery models available for this device. This
device is intended for use when supplied with power from
the following chargers: AC-8. The exact charger model
number may vary depending on the type of plug. The plug
variant is identified by one of the following: E, EB, X, AR, U, A,
C, K, or UB.
The battery can be charged and discharged hundreds of
times, but it will eventually wear out. When the talk and
standby times are noticeably shorter than normal, replace the
battery. Use only Nokia approved batteries, and recharge
your battery only with Nokia approved chargers designated
for this device.
If a battery is being used for the first time or if the battery has
not been used for a prolonged period, it may be necessary to
connect the charger, then disconnect and reconnect it to
begin charging the battery. If the battery is completely
discharged, it may take several minutes before the charging
indicator appears on the display or before any calls can be
made.
Safe removal. Always switch the device off and disconnect the
charger before removing the battery.
